Mark Todd Preece

April 7, 1961 — August 31, 2024

Mark Todd Preece (63) of Kaysville, Utah passed away peacefully in his sleep at home on Saturday August 31, 2024.

 He was born April 7, 1961, to Mark Vernon Preece and Maryann Preece in Logan, Utah. He graduated from Davis High School in 1979. Shortly after graduation he moved to Cache Valley where he worked at Mountain Farms Cheese and met Dawn Greenlee (Wilson) and later married. They had three children before divorcing in 1986.

 He had a great life with his kids, teaching them about life, how to shoot guns, play sports, cards and also taking them camping, fishing and hiking.

 Mark is survived by his mother Maryann Preece, daughter Tonya Preece, daughter Lynze Preece, along with grandchildren, Dallas, Christian, Tyson, Skye, Kanyon, Serenity, Faith, Mea and Savannah, great granddaughter Amira, and his dog “Renny” (Renegade).

 He is preceded in death by his older brother Val, father Mark Vernon Preece and son Dustin Preece.

 The family would like to thank Joshua and the staff at Lindquist’s Mortuary for their help in their time of need.

 Funeral services will be held Thursday September 12, 2024, at 2:00 p.m. at Lindquist’s Kaysville Mortuary, 400 N. main St. Kaysville, Utah. Friends may visit with family Wednesday September 11, 2024, from 6:00 to 8:00 p.m. and Thursday from 12:30 to 1:30 p.m. at the mortuary.
